Bill Walsh in Bulldog blue

Bill Walsh, wearing number 77, played quarterback for CSM from 1951-52. He then transferred to San Jose State in 1953. After Graduating, he began an outstanding coaching career, becoming a head coach at Stanford University before being hired by the San Francisco 49ers. From 1979-1988 Mr. Walsh won three Superbowls. Diagnosed with leukemia in 2004, the NFL Hall-of-Famer died on July 30, 2007 of the disease. He was 75.
